/* Max width 767px
<<<<=====================================================================>>>>*/
@media only screen and (max-width: 767px) {
  body {
    font-size: 15px;
  }
  .ptb-100 {
    padding-top: 60px;
    padding-bottom: 60px;
  }
  .pt-100 {
    padding-top: 60px;
  }
  .pb-100 {
    padding-bottom: 60px;
  }
  .pt-75 {
    padding-top: 35px;
  }
  .pb-75 {
    padding-bottom: 35px;
  }
  .pt-70 {
    padding-top: 35px;
  }
  .pb-70 {
    padding-bottom: 35px;
  }
  p {
    font-size: 15px;
  }
  .main-btn {
    padding: 8.5px 12px;
    font-size: 15px;
  }
  .banner-content {
    margin-bottom: 30px;
  }
  .banner-content h2 {
    font-size: 35px;
    margin-bottom: 15px;
  }
  .banner-content p {
    margin-bottom: 25px;
    max-width: 100%;
  }
  .banner-content .banner-btn {
    margin-bottom: 20px;
  }
  .banner-content .communities {
    margin-bottom: 15px;
  }
  .support-response-single-item {
    padding: 30px;
  }
  .support-response-single-item p {
    font-size: 16px;
  }
  .support-response-single-item span {
    font-size: 30px;
  }
  .section-title h2 {
    font-size: 30px;
  }
  .process-single-item {
    margin-bottom: 25px;
  }
  .process-single-item .nish {
    display: none;
  }
  .process-single-item .nish-2 {
    display: none;
  }
  .process-single-item.mt-60 {
    margin-top: 0;
  }
  .trading-content {
    margin-bottom: 30px;
  }
  .trading-content h2 {
    font-size: 30px;
    margin-bottom: 20px;
  }
  .trading-img {
    margin: auto;
    max-width: 100%;
  }
  .configuration-area {
    margin-left: 0;
    margin-right: 0;
  }
  .evaluation-program .amount-tag li {
    margin-right: 20px;
  }
  .evaluation-program .evaluation-tab a {
    padding: 10px 50px;
  }
  .configuration-area .table {
    width: 670px;
  }
  .together-single-item {
    padding: 20px;
  }
  .together-single-item h3 {
    font-size: 20px;
  }
  .friends-content {
    padding: 30px;
  }
  .friends-content .friends-content-wrap h2 {
    font-size: 30px;
    margin-bottom: 15px;
  }
  .friends-content .friends-content-wrap p {
    margin-bottom: 20px;
  }
  .questions-wrap.accordion .accordion-item .accordion-header .accordion-button {
    padding: 20px;
  }
  .questions-wrap.accordion .accordion-item .accordion-body {
    padding: 20px;
    padding-top: 0;
  }
  .questions-wrap.accordion .accordion-item .accordion-collapse.show::before {
    top: -130px;
  }
  .footer-single-item.style-border {
    border-right: none;
    padding-right: 0;
    margin-right: 0;
  }
  .contact-us-form {
    padding: 25px;
  }
  .answered-tabs .nav-item .nav-link {
    padding: 10px;
  }
  .privacy-policy-content h3 {
    font-size: 20px;
    font-weight: 500;
  }
  .get-started-single-item {
    margin-bottom: 50px;
  }
  .get-started-single-item .get-started-count {
    border: none;
  }
  .get-started-single-item .get-started-count::before {
    display: none;
  }
  .dreamer-wrap .owl-theme .owl-nav .owl-next, .dreamer-wrap .owl-theme .owl-nav .owl-prev {
    right: 0;
    position: unset;
  }
  .dreamer-area {
    margin-left: 0;
    margin-right: 0;
  }
  .counter-single-item::before {
    display: none;
  }
  .counter-single-item::after {
    display: none;
  }
  .team-arae {
    margin-left: 0;
    margin-right: 0;
  }
  .account-information {
    padding: 20px;
  }
  .payment-method .choose-payment {
    padding: 20px;
  }
  .friends-content .friends-content-wrap .main-btn {
    padding: 15.5px 25px;
    font-size: 16px;
  }
  .answered-tabs .nav-item .nav-link {
    padding: 10px 25px;
  }
}
/* Min width 768px to Max width 991px 
<<<<=====================================================================>>>>*/
@media only screen and (min-width: 768px) and (max-width: 991px) {
  .ptb-100 {
    padding-top: 60px;
    padding-bottom: 60px;
  }
  .pt-100 {
    padding-top: 60px;
  }
  .pb-100 {
    padding-bottom: 60px;
  }
  .pt-75 {
    padding-top: 35px;
  }
  .pb-75 {
    padding-bottom: 35px;
  }
  .pt-70 {
    padding-top: 35px;
  }
  .pb-70 {
    padding-bottom: 35px;
  }
  .shape {
    display: none;
  }
  .banner-content {
    margin-bottom: 30px;
  }
  .banner-content h2 {
    font-size: 50px;
    margin-bottom: 15px;
  }
  .banner-content p {
    margin-bottom: 25px;
    max-width: 100%;
  }
  .banner-content .banner-btn {
    margin-bottom: 20px;
  }
  .banner-content .communities {
    margin-bottom: 15px;
  }
  .support-response-single-item {
    padding: 30px;
  }
  .support-response-single-item p {
    font-size: 16px;
  }
  .support-response-single-item span {
    font-size: 30px;
  }
  .section-title h2 {
    font-size: 40px;
  }
  .process-single-item {
    margin-bottom: 25;
  }
  .process-single-item .nish {
    display: none;
  }
  .process-single-item .nish-2 {
    display: none;
  }
  .process-single-item.mt-60 {
    margin-top: 0;
  }
  .process-wrap .row {
    --bs-gutter-x: 35px;
  }
  .trading-content {
    margin-bottom: 30px;
  }
  .trading-content h2 {
    font-size: 40px;
    margin-bottom: 20px;
  }
  .trading-img {
    margin: auto;
    max-width: 100%;
  }
  .configuration-area .table {
    width: 670px;
  }
  .configuration-area {
    margin-left: 50px;
    margin-right: 50px;
  }
  .friends-content {
    padding: 30px;
  }
  .friends-content .friends-content-wrap h2 {
    font-size: 40px;
    margin-bottom: 20px;
  }
  .friends-content .friends-content-wrap p {
    margin-bottom: 25px;
  }
  .footer-single-item.style-border {
    border-right: none;
    padding-right: 0;
    margin-right: 0;
  }
  .privacy-policy-content h3 {
    font-size: 20px;
    font-weight: 500;
  }
  .get-started-single-item {
    margin-bottom: 50px;
  }
  .get-started-single-item .get-started-count {
    border: none;
  }
  .get-started-single-item .get-started-count::before {
    display: none;
  }
  .dreamer-area {
    margin-left: 0;
    margin-right: 0;
  }
  .dreamer-wrap .owl-theme .owl-nav .owl-next, .dreamer-wrap .owl-theme .owl-nav .owl-prev {
    right: 0;
    position: unset;
  }
  .dreamer-area {
    margin-left: 0;
    margin-right: 0;
  }
  .team-arae {
    margin-left: 0;
    margin-right: 0;
  }
}
/* Min width 992px to Max width 1199px 
<<<<=====================================================================>>>>*/
@media only screen and (min-width: 992px) and (max-width: 1199px) {
  .navbar-area .navbar-brand {
    margin-right: 30px;
  }
  .navbar-area.style-two .nav-right-options .main-btn {
    padding: 10.5px 18px;
  }
  .navbar-area.style-two .nav-right-options .main-btn i {
    display: none;
  }
  .main-nav .navbar .navbar-nav .nav-item .nav-link {
    margin-left: 10px;
    margin-right: 10px;
  }
  .main-nav .nav-right-options .language {
    margin-right: 15px;
  }
  .banner-content h2 {
    font-size: 50px;
    margin-bottom: 15px;
  }
  .banner-content p {
    margin-bottom: 25px;
    max-width: 100%;
  }
  .banner-content .banner-btn {
    margin-bottom: 20px;
  }
  .banner-content .communities {
    margin-bottom: 15px;
  }
  .support-response-single-item {
    padding: 20px;
  }
  .support-response-single-item p {
    font-size: 16px;
  }
  .support-response-single-item span {
    font-size: 30px;
  }
  .configuration-area {
    margin-left: 50px;
    margin-right: 50px;
  }
}
/* Min width 1200px to Max width 1320px 
<<<<=====================================================================>>>>*/
@media only screen and (min-width: 1200px) and (max-width: 1550px) {
  .navbar-area .navbar-brand {
    margin-right: 100px;
  }
  .navbar-area.style-two .nav-right-options .main-btn {
    padding: 10.5px 18px;
  }
  .navbar-area.style-two .nav-right-options .main-btn i {
    margin-left: 5px;
  }
  .support-response-single-item {
    padding: 50px 25px;
  }
}
/* Medium devices (tablets, 768px and up) Only Mobil Menu
===========================================================*/
@media only screen and (max-width: 991px) {
  /* Navbar Style
  <<<<=====================>>>>*/
  .navbar-area {
    z-index: 2;
    padding-top: 20px;
    padding-bottom: 20px;
  }
  .navbar-area .dropdown-toggle::after {
    display: none;
  }
  .navbar-area .mobile-nav {
    display: block;
  }
  .navbar-area .mobile-nav .mobile-menu {
    position: relative;
  }
  .navbar-area .mobile-nav .mobile-menu.mean-container .mean-nav {
    margin-top: 46px;
    background-color: #ffffff;
    -webkit-box-shadow: 0 0 20px 3px rgba(0, 0, 0, 0.05);
            box-shadow: 0 0 20px 3px rgba(0, 0, 0, 0.05);
  }
  .navbar-area .mobile-nav .mobile-menu.mean-container .mean-nav ul {
    border: none !important;
    background-color: #ffffff;
  }
  .navbar-area .mobile-nav .mobile-menu.mean-container .mean-nav ul li a {
    border-top-color: #efefef;
    color: #ffffff !important;
    font-size: 16px;
    font-weight: 400;
    text-transform: capitalize;
  }
  .navbar-area .mobile-nav .mobile-menu.mean-container .mean-nav ul li a.active {
    color: #FFF1B9 !important;
  }
  .navbar-area .mobile-nav .mobile-menu.mean-container .mean-nav ul li a.mean-expand {
    width: 100%;
    height: 28px;
    text-align: right;
    padding: 11px !important;
    background: transparent !important;
    border-left: none !important;
    border-bottom: none !important;
  }
  .navbar-area .mobile-nav .mobile-menu.mean-container .meanmenu-reveal {
    top: 0;
    padding: 0;
    width: 35px;
    height: 30px;
    padding-top: 6px;
    color: #FFF1B9;
  }
  .navbar-area .mobile-nav .mobile-menu.mean-container .meanmenu-reveal span {
    background: #FFF1B9;
    height: 4px;
    margin-top: -6px;
    border-radius: 0;
    position: relative;
    top: 8px;
  }
  .navbar-area .mobile-nav .mobile-menu.mean-container .mean-bar {
    background: transparent;
    position: absolute;
    z-index: 2;
    padding: 0;
  }
  .navbar-area .mobile-nav .others-options {
    display: none !important;
  }
  .navbar-area .main-nav {
    display: none !important;
  }
  .navbar-area .nav-right-options {
    position: absolute;
    top: 7px;
    right: 45px;
  }
  .navbar-area .nav-right-options .language {
    padding-left: 0;
    margin-bottom: 0;
    list-style: none;
    position: relative;
    padding-left: 22px;
    margin-right: 35px;
  }
  .navbar-area .nav-right-options .language .form-select {
    padding: 0;
    padding-right: 20px;
    background-color: transparent;
    background-position: right -4px center;
    border: none;
    font-size: 15px;
    font-weight: 500;
    color: #ffffff;
    cursor: pointer;
    background-image: url(../../assets/images/arrow-down.svg);
  }
  .navbar-area .nav-right-options .language .form-select:focus {
    -webkit-box-shadow: none;
            box-shadow: none;
  }
  .navbar-area .nav-right-options .language .form-select option {
    color: #ffffff;
  }
  .navbar-area .nav-right-options .language i {
    position: absolute;
    top: 50%;
    -webkit-transform: translateY(-50%);
            transform: translateY(-50%);
    left: 0;
    font-size: 16px;
    color: #ffffff;
  }
  .navbar-area .nav-right-options .src-btn {
    background-color: transparent;
    font-size: 16px;
  }
  .navbar-area .nav-right-options .menu-btn {
    background-color: transparent;
    font-size: 16px;
    margin-left: 20px;
    margin-right: 10px;
  }
  .navbar-area.style-two {
    border-bottom: 1px solid rgba(255, 255, 255, 0.05);
    padding-top: 20px !important;
    padding-bottom: 20px !important;
  }
  .navbar-area.style-three {
    border-bottom: 1px solid #dddddd;
  }
  .mean-container .mean-nav ul li a.mean-expand {
    top: -6px;
  }
  .navbar-area .mobile-nav .mobile-menu.mean-container .mean-nav ul {
    background-color: #1b0c3b;
  }
  .col-lg-6.mb-30.mew-Account.Type {
    margin-left: 0;
  }
  .woocommerce table.shop_table, .woocommerce-cart #payment, .woocommerce-checkout #payment, #add_payment_method #payment {
    padding: 10px;
  }
  .single-checkout-widget.mb-25 {
    margin-top: 25px;
  }
  .extra-padding {
    padding-bottom: 30px !important;
  }
}
/* Medium devices 1400px
===========================================================*/
@media only screen and (min-width: 1400px) {
  .container {
    max-width: 1250px;
  }
}/*# sourceMappingURL=responsive.css.map */